Ulster winger, Andrew Trimble, has been selected by Ireland Coach, Joe Schmidt, in his starting XV to face Scotland (RBS 6 Nations / Aviva Stadium / 15:00).
Trimble won his 50th cap for Ireland, against Canada last summer, but he wasn’t selected for the Autumn Internationals.
He joins his fellow Ulster players, Luke Marshall, Rory Best and Chris Henry in the side as Ireland begin their first RBS 6 Nations campaign under Schmidt.
Paddy Jackson is named on the bench, as is Dan Tuohy.
Commenting on the selection of Trimble, Schmidt said:
“His last two performances for Ulster have been really good. Wing is a highly contested position and Andrew has first run at it. He is a physical winger, good in the air. Defensively he can close down pretty efficiently so that is why we have opted for him there.”
Brian O'Driscoll and Rob Kearney will both reach significant career milestones when they line out against Scotland at the Aviva Stadium on Sunday afternoon.
Meanwhile, Brian O'Driscoll will earn his 129th cap on Sunday and will become Ireland's most capped player of all time. Rob Kearney will claim his 50th cap for Ireland.
Paul O'Connell captain's the side and will be partnered in the second row by Devin Toner. The front-row is made up of Leinster duo Cian Healy and Mike Ross with Best at hooker.
Henry starts at openside with Munster captain Peter O'Mahony on the blindside and Jamie Heaslip at No.8.
Conor Murray partners Johnny Sexton at half-back with Luke Marshall and Brian O'Driscoll partnered in the centre. The back three sees Rob Kearney at fullback and Dave Kearney and Trimble on the wings.
